True Food Kitchen is a health-focused, full-service restaurant chain founded in 2008, operating in the casual dining sector. With a menu built around anti-inflammatory ingredients and seasonal rotations, the company caters to a growing consumer demand for nutritious, flavorful meals in a restaurant setting. Operating at a scale of 1,001-5,000 employees, True Food Kitchen manages a distributed network of locations, each requiring precise coordination of supply chains, kitchen operations, labor, and guest experience to maintain its brand promise and profitability.
Why AI matters at this scale
For a mid-market, multi-location restaurant chain, manual processes and intuition-based decisions become significant liabilities. At this size band, small inefficiencies in food waste, labor scheduling, or marketing spend are multiplied across dozens of locations, eroding already thin margins. AI provides the data-driven precision needed to optimize these core functions systematically. It transforms scattered operational data—from point-of-sale systems, inventory counts, and guest feedback—into actionable intelligence, enabling the consistency and efficiency required for sustainable growth and competitive differentiation in a crowded market.
Concrete AI Opportunities with ROI Framing
1. AI-Driven Demand Forecasting and Inventory Management: By implementing machine learning models that analyze historical sales, local events, weather, and even traffic patterns, True Food Kitchen can predict daily ingredient needs per location with high accuracy. This directly reduces food spoilage, a major cost center. A conservative estimate of a 15-25% reduction in waste could save hundreds of thousands of dollars annually, paying for the AI solution within its first year while also supporting sustainability goals.
2. Personalized Guest Experience at Scale: Leveraging data from the loyalty program and online orders, AI can segment customers and predict their preferences. Automated, personalized email campaigns suggesting new seasonal items or offering a discount on a frequently ordered dish can increase visit frequency and average check size. This turns generic marketing into a high-return investment, fostering deeper brand loyalty and directly boosting same-store sales.
3. Optimized Labor Scheduling and Task Management: AI tools can forecast customer footfall down to the hour for each restaurant. By automating schedule creation to align staff with predicted demand, management can control one of the largest variable costs—labor—while ensuring service quality during rushes. This improves employee satisfaction by reducing last-minute call-ins and overtime, and can lead to a 3-5% reduction in labor costs.
Deployment Risks Specific to This Size Band
For a company with 1,001-5,000 employees, deployment risks are distinct. Integration Complexity is a primary hurdle; legacy point-of-sale systems, kitchen display systems, and various vendor platforms may not communicate easily, creating data silos that cripple AI effectiveness. Change Management across a dispersed workforce of managers and kitchen staff is daunting; without proper training and clear communication of benefits, AI tools may be ignored or misused. Upfront Investment and ROI Uncertainty can be a barrier for mid-market firms without the vast capital reserves of giant chains; a failed pilot could strain budgets. Finally, Data Quality and Governance is often an issue—inconsistent data entry across locations can lead to flawed AI insights, making a foundational data cleanup and standardization effort a critical, non-negotiable first step.
